Engaging Policymakers
How Site Visits and Events Can Inspire Policy Change to Support Your Program
Thursday, September 6
1-2pm central/CST
Register here: https://attendee.gotowebinar.com/register/5053583384676796928
 
Now that the federal Safe Routes to School program has been lumped into the general 'Transportation Alternatives' pot, and because the federal transportation law only lasts for two years, it is ever so critical that we create as many policymaker champions for Safe Routes to School as we can! Getting policymakers out to promotional events such as Walk to School Day on October 3, site visits to see Walking School Buses or Bike Safety Education classes, and other "Show Me" events, can be critical for our future. Your Safe Routes to School program will thrive when policies and funding help your program to sustain and grow.
 
Learn how to put on a great event, why it is important to get policymakers involved and how you can use your local or state Safe Routes to School program promotion to inspire policy change and build Safe Routes to School into the fabric of your community.
 
This webinar is the fourth in a series of monthly webinars on topics related to Safe Routes to School and other policy and program initiatives that can increase walking and bicycling to school and in daily life.
